A Russian ammunition warehouse has been destroyed by Ukrainian strikes as the war between the two countries continues, reports say.According to footage posted on X, formerly Twitter, on June 23, Ukraine struck an ammunition storage point in Kursk, which is close to the Ukrainian border, causing an explosion.
